MySQL Bit PHP編程是一個非常常見的技術,它可以用來處理二進制數據類型。由于在現代計算機科學中二進制被廣泛使用,因此,MySQL Bit PHP編程已經成為了軟件開發領域中不可或缺的一部分。
MySQL Bit PHP編程的例子很多,最常見的就是在處理用戶權限控制方面的應用。比如,許多論壇系統通常都會讓管理員對每個用戶設置一個特定的權限級別。這些權限級別通常用二進制數值來表示。例如,管理員是1,版主是2,會員是4,普通用戶是8,等等。在這種情況下,MySQL和PHP可以很快地處理這些二進制權限級別數據類型,從而為用戶的訪問控制提供完美的支持。
在實際應用中,MySQL Bit PHP編程的例子很多,比如可以用它來檢查一個二進制數據類型中特定的位是否被設置。例如,如果一個權限級別是3(管理員和版主),那么我們可以使用以下PHP代碼在MySQL數據庫中查詢用戶權限數據:
//檢查用戶權限與管理員和版主的匹配結果是否正確 $permission = 3; $sql = "SELECT * FROM user_permissions WHERE bitwise & $permission >0"; $resultset = mysql_query($sql);這個SQL查詢會查找在user_permissions表中所有權限級別等于或高于管理員和版主級別的用戶。這樣,我們就可以很容易地找到具有相同權限的所有用戶,從而輕松地管理每個用戶的訪問權限。 MySQL Bit PHP編程還有許多其他的用途。例如,可以用它來加密和解密數據,保護信息安全。比如,在PHP中使用以下代碼來對數據進行加密:
$data = "This is confidential data"; $key = "my_secret_key"; $encrypted_data = openssl_encrypt($data, "AES-256-CBC", $key);在這里,我們使用了PHP提供的openssl_encrypt函數,將數據加密為一個二進制數據類型。然后,我們可以將這個加密后的數據存儲到MySQL數據庫中,以此來保護信息安全。 總之,MySQL Bit PHP編程廣泛應用于軟件開發領域,并且使用十分靈活。在處理二進制數據類型方面,它也展現了非凡的性能和處理速度。通過使用MySQL和PHP來處理二進制數據類型,我們可以輕松地處理并管理大量的數據,從而提高我們的工作效率。